Output 531d08acbdff93633bbc0372ee202c00ac66b175a397972084513ff3c8ef10e9:0

value
24738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ebf3b7f8b91ce03717c7b1f4291d5b4e24ef7f2 OP_EQUAL
address
3BnbLhv17jHb3yBrH44kzjaffdkpLEw5Lr
transaction
531d08acbdff93633bbc0372ee202c00ac66b175a397972084513ff3c8ef10e9
spent
true